原文:25 | MySQL是怎么保證高可用的?

在上一篇文章中,我和你介紹了binlog的基本內容,在一個主備關系中,每個備庫接收主庫的binlog並執行。 正常情況下,只要主庫執行更新生成的所有binlog,都可以傳到備庫並被正確地執行,備庫就能達到跟主庫一致的狀態,這就是最終一致性。 但是,MySQL要提供高可用能力,只有最終一致性是不夠的。為什么這么說呢 今天我就着重和你分析一下。 這里,我再放一次上一篇文章中講到的雙M結構的主備切換流程 ...

2019-01-24 13:21 0 694 推薦指數:

查看詳情

如何保證Redis的可用

什么是可用   全年時間里,99%的時間里都能對外提供服務,就是可用 主備切換   在master故障時,自動檢測,將某個slave切換為master的過程,叫做主備切換。這個過程,實現了Redis主從架構下的可用性。 哨兵是redis集群架構中非 ...

Sat Dec 01 00:15:00 CST 2018 0 1725
如何保證消息隊列是可用

為什么寫這篇文章? 博主有兩位朋友分別是小A和小B: 小A,工作於傳統軟件行業(某社保局的軟件外包公司),每天工作內容就是和產品聊聊需求,改改業務邏輯。再不然就是和運營聊聊天,寫幾個SQL, ...

Mon Mar 25 18:54:00 CST 2019 1 731
如何保證消息隊列的可用

RabbitMQ的可用性   RabbitMQ是基於主從做可用性的,有三種模式:單機模式,普通集群模式,鏡像集群模式 單機模式:   demo級別 普通集群模式:   在多台機器上啟動rabbitmq實例,每個機器啟動一個。   但是你創建的queue,只會 ...

Fri Nov 23 00:35:00 CST 2018 0 1531
如何保證消息隊列的可用

面試題 如何保證消息隊列的可用? 面試官心理分析 如果有人問到你 MQ 的知識,可用是必問的。上一講提到,MQ 會導致系統可用性降低。所以只要你用了 MQ,接下來問的一些要點肯定就是圍繞着 MQ 的那些缺點怎么來解決了。 要是你傻乎乎的就干用了一個 MQ,各種問題從來沒考慮過,那你 ...

Wed Sep 11 07:40:00 CST 2019 0 459
Kafka如何保證消息的可用

一、術語 1.1 Broker Kafka 集群包含一個或多個服務器,服務器節點稱為broker。 broker存儲topic的數據。 如果某topic有N個partition,集群有N個br ...

Mon Apr 22 05:06:00 CST 2019 0 793
redis可用保證並發

redis主從架構下如何才能做到99.99%的可用性? redis哨兵架構的相關基礎知 ...

Wed May 15 18:32:00 CST 2019 0 469
怎么保證redis集群的並發和可用的?

redis不支持並發的瓶頸在哪里? 單機.單機版的redis支持上萬到幾萬的QPS不等.   主要根據你的業務操作的復雜性,redis提供了很多復雜的操作,lua腳本. 2.如果redis要支撐超過10萬+()怎么解決? 單機版的redis幾乎不可能說QPS超過10萬+,除非一些 ...

Tue Jul 09 06:10:00 CST 2019 0 2978
MySQL可用(一)主備同步:MySQL是如何保證主備一致的

主備同步,也叫主從復制,是MySQL提供的一種可用的解決方案,保證主備數據一致性的解決方案。 在生產環境中,會有很多不可控因素,例如數據庫服務掛了。為了保證應用的可用,數據庫也必須要是可用的。 因此在生產環境中,都會采用主備同步。在應用的規模不大的情況下,一般會采用一主一備。 除了上面 ...

Tue Dec 22 00:16:00 CST 2020 0 1487
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M